I ran DSII on my 200 I6 when I still had it. I went through 3 coils before figuring it all out. I ran a setup saying that I had to cut the pink resistor wire under the dash to get 12V to the box. Well I did that and coils were going left and right, I had a Flamethrower coil last 1 day. My stock one lasted 3, and replacement lasted 1. Reconnected that pink wire and bam, everything worked great and I never had a problem.
I used this schematic, minus the pink wire.

Well, I stand corrected. I turned the ignition to the 'on' position, put my volt meter to the red wire that powers the coil and the ignition module and it read 6.9V. I'm not sure why I thought it was running 12, but I guess it isn't.
I suppose its possible it may change if the car was actually running, but I wouldn't think so. I could check that for you as well if you like.
